Salespeople at a car dealership in Florida (USA) shared which cars they believe indicate that the customer is going through a midlife crisis.

The video was shared by Enter Erdman Automotivewhile the cameraman went around the store asking the salespeople which cars scream “midlife crisis” the most, according to them.

One of the first questions asked was TJwho was quick to respond: “Corvetteperiod.” He said that he often receives an older person wanting a Corvettebut quipped: “You can’t even bend down to get into one.”

Several salespeople in the store agreed with TJ’s position and also pointed out the Corvette. Others mentioned the Mazda Miatao BMWo Ford Mustango Chevrolet Camaroo Polaris Slingshoto Toyota Supra and until the Nissan Z.

The video has already received more than 900 thousand views. But in the comments, most internet users agreed that older people buy Corvettes simply because that’s when they can finally afford to buy one.

“I wanted a Corvette all my life. It’s not a midlife crisis, it’s when you can actually afford one,” said one TikTok user. “So I’ve been in a midlife crisis my whole life. My dream car is a Corvette 69“, admitted another.
